General annotation (Comments)
| Function | Mitogen-activated protein kinase involved in a signal transduction pathway that is activated by changes in the osmolarity of the extracellular environment. Controls osmotic regulation of transcription of target genes By similarity. Involved in resistence to osmotic stress and tolerance to methylglyoxal and citric acid. |
| Catalytic activity | ATP + a protein = ADP + a phosphoprotein. |
| Cofactor | Magnesium By similarity. |
| Enzyme regulation | Activated by tyrosine and threonine phosphorylation By similarity. |
| Subcellular location | |
| Domain | The TXY motif contains the threonine and tyrosine residues whose phosphorylation activates the MAP kinases. |
| Post-translational modification | Dually phosphorylated on Thr-174 and Tyr-176, which activates the enzyme By similarity. Phosphorylated during osmotic stress. |
| Sequence similarities | Belongs to the protein kinase superfamily. Ser/Thr protein kinase family. MAP kinase subfamily. HOG1 sub-subfamily. Contains 1 protein kinase domain. |
